Obama 'Unimpressed' Photo with O.C. Native Gymnast Goes Viral
According to a local blog, President Obama kidded about McKayla Maroney's "not impressed" look while greeting her and members of the 2012 U.S. Olympic gymnastics teams in the Oval Office.
Southern California Public Radio Blog reports a photo of gold medalist and Laguna Niguel native McKayla Maroney and President Barack Obama went viral Saturday.
"The photo of her doing her now-famous "McKayla Maroney is not impressed" face went viral Saturday after the White House posted it on Twitter. The two took the picture Thursday when Maroney and her Fierce Five teammates visited the White House," the blog reports.
The photo can also be seen here at the White House Twitter feed. The photo was snapped by AP photographer Pete Souza / The White House on Nov. 15.

"He was the one who brought it up," Maroney told The Associated Press. "We were about to leave and he said, 'I want to talk to you one second about the face.' He said, 'I pretty much do that face at least once a day,'" says the blog.
Maroney was photographed making the half scowl with her nose scrunched up while she was on the medals podium after winning silver on vault at the London Olympics.
